Kelley Frank DPM Foot Doctor Elk Grove Village IL

Providing solutions to your foot problems

Foot problems do not get better by themselves. Letting your foot discomfort linger for weeks or months can ultimately lead to bigger problems, including lower back pain and issues with your hips and knees.

When you experience foot and ankle problems you need to consult a foot doctor who listens and responds …an experienced podiatrist who has the expertise to effectively diagnose and treat your problem. Whether you’re looking for information on heel pain, diabetic foot care, bunions, hammertoes, foot surgery and wound care Dr. Frank can provide the help you need.

Dr. Kelley Frank is the type of foot doctor and foot surgeon you  want on your team. She will give you the individual personalized attention you deserve along with a treatment plan to solve your problem quickly and affordably.

Seek the help of a foot doctor if you experience…

  • Foot and ankle pain that doesn’t go away
  • Discoloration of the skin on your foot or near your nails
  • If you notice severe cracking or pealing near the heel or foot
  • Blisters that appear on your feet.
  • If you are diabetic and/or have poor circulation
  • Notice the signs of Athlete’s foot or ingrown toenails.
  • Experience swelling, pain, or redness
  • Red marks or streaking from a site of pain
  • Infection or drainage
  • If you’ve tried non-prescribed treatments and they are not helping after two weeks
  • Thickening toenails that cause discomfort.
  • Heel pain
  • Need custom orthotics in the treatment of heel pain or flat feet
  • Fever, redness
  • Numbness
  • Tingling in the heel; or consistent heel pain 

Comfortable office for your treatment

As an Elk Grove Village Podiatrist, Dr. Frank tries to make the office as efficient and comfortable for her patients. On this website you’ll find location, map, directions hours and insurance policies.

Latest technology


Convenient appointment times

You may request an appointment by using the form on the right column of this page. Just let us know what time fits for your schedule. We’ll give you a call to confirm your request. You may also give us a call at 847-258-5524.